Burnham-On-Sea’s Princess Theatre Company will be performing a series of short plays this Friday (April 27th) that are sure to entertain audiences.

The seven short plays will form part of an evening of comedy and drama called ‘PTV in Shorts 2’ at Burnham’s Princess Theatre this Friday at 7pm.

Following the success of last year’s evening of shorts plays, the theatre group will be presenting their new catalogue of original mini dramas.

“The questions we are answering in 2018 are: Where is Jake’s leg? What did happen on that mountain? Is smart living the smart way to go? When did John MacDonald become Jonny Mac? Does money really make you happy? How many groats does it cost for a medieval MOT?”
